This is a pencil sketch of a woman's head titled "Gebogen vrouwenhoofd" (Bent Woman's Head) by Dutch artist George Hendrik Breitner. The drawing was created between 1880-1882, and is characteristic of Breitner's early style. The sketch is housed in the Rijksmuseum, Amsterdam, and is an intimate depiction of a woman's profile, highlighting the artist's focus on capturing the human form with loose, expressive lines. The quick strokes and incomplete details convey a sense of movement and energy, highlighting the artist's talent for observing and recording fleeting moments in his surroundings.
